"Living in Darkness" is a mystery novel by John A. Roynesdal that delves into the lives of detectives Nick Keone and Paul Noa of the Special Division Detective Team (SDDT) in Honolulu. The story follows their investigation into a series of brutal attacks and murders, which they suspect are hate crimes targeting young gay men. As they uncover the identity of the killer, the novel explores themes of prejudice, revenge, and the impact of societal stigma on individuals. The book is part of Roynesdal's Phillip Michael Carnegie mystery series, which has been well-received for its portrayal of complex characters and the challenges they face in solving crimes.
